Table 1.
The accuracy, sensitivity, and specificity of each CNN design (single modality vs. dual modality vs. multimodality) in classification of three cohorts of YH, OH, and AMD.
| Patient cohort | |||
|---|---|---|---|
| YH | OH | AMD | |
| Single modality CNN | Overall accuracy 94.4% | ||
| OCT sensitivity (%) | 99.6 | 98.9 | 77.8 |
| OCT specificity (%) | 98.8 | 86.7 | 100 |
| Single modality CNN | Overall accuracy 91.9% | ||
| OCT-A sensitivity (%) | 95.5 | 83.2 | 97.6 |
| OCT-A specificity (%) | 99.6 | 96.2 | 76.4 |
| Single modality CNN | Overall accuracy 93.8% | ||
| CFP sensitivity (%) | 81.0 | 84.6 | 100 |
| CFP specificity (%) | 94.4 | 78.6 | 86.7 |
| Dual modality CNN (OCT + OCT-A) | Overall accuracy 96.7% | ||
| Sensitivity (%) | 100 | 95.7 | 92.1 |
| Specificity (%) | 97.6 | 94.6 | 98.7 |
| Dual modality CNN (OCT + CFP) | Overall accuracy 92.9% | ||
| Sensitivity (%) | 98.1 | 96.3 | 100 |
| Specificity (%) | 100 | 97.0 | 96.0 |
| Multimodality CNN (OCT + OCT-A + CFP) | Overall accuracy 99.8% | ||
| Sensitivity (%) | 100 | 99.3 | 100 |
| Specificity (%) | 100 | 100 | 99.2 |
